Portable Speakers
Some bass Bluetooth speakers are portable, making them convenient for travel or outdoor activities. These speakers are typically lightweight, compact, and often come with a durable design, allowing you to take your music anywhere. Look for battery life, ease of connection, and sound quality when choosing a portable option.

Sound Quality
With sound quality being a primary concern, you should look for speakers that deliver clear and powerful bass without distortion. Pay attention to the specifications like frequency response and driver size, as they significantly influence audio performance.
Battery Life
Some speakers offer a variety of battery life options, which can be a determining factor based on your usage patterns. A longer battery life means you can enjoy your music without interruptions, especially during outdoor activities or long events.
Factors influencing battery life include the speaker’s size, volume level, and the type of audio being played. It’s imperative to choose a speaker that balances sound quality and battery efficiency according to how you plan to use it. Look for models that provide a quick charge feature for added convenience on the go.

Disadvantages
While bass Bluetooth speakers come with great benefits, they also have some drawbacks. The cost can be a significant factor, as these speakers can be pricier compared to standard Bluetooth options. Additionally, battery life may become a concern, as you may find yourself needing to charge them frequently with heavy usage.
Another downside is the audio quality, as it may suffer when you move further away from the speaker. Distortion can also occur at higher volume levels, which may reduce sound clarity. Understanding these disadvantages will help you assess whether investing in a bass Bluetooth speaker aligns with your needs and expectations.

Pairing with Devices
You will need to pair your Bass Bluetooth speaker with your smartphone, tablet, or any other Bluetooth-enabled device. This process typically takes just a couple of minutes.
Understanding the pairing process is necessary for a smooth setup. Begin by enabling Bluetooth on your device, then look for your speaker in the list of available devices. After selecting it, your device might prompt you to confirm the connection. Once paired, you can enjoy your music without the hassle of wires, appreciating the convenience that Bluetooth offers.
Updating Firmware
For optimal performance, it’s important to update your speaker’s firmware regularly. Manufacturers often release software updates to enhance functionality, fix bugs, and improve sound quality. By keeping the firmware current, you ensure that your speaker can utilize the latest technology and features.
It’s necessary to check the manufacturer’s website or app for firmware updates periodically. Installation is often simple and can typically be completed through your computer or mobile device. Make sure your speaker is fully charged before starting the update process, and keep it connected to a reliable power source to prevent interruptions. Regular updates will help you enjoy the best possible sound experience from your Bass Bluetooth speaker.
